Understanding the Nintendo Switch Platform

Overview of Nintendo Switch Features

The Nintendo Switch is a revolutionary gaming console that transcends traditional boundaries. Launched in March 2017, it brought together the best aspects of portable and home gaming into one versatile device. The Switch features a 6.2-inch touchscreen display—perfect for portable play—and can be docked for a seamless experience on your TV. With its detachable Joy-Con controllers, the platform allows for versatile gameplay styles, whether you’re playing alone on the go or enjoying local co-op with friends.

The Nintendo Switch supports various game genres and is well-known for its exclusive titles like Mario, Zelda, and Pokémon. Since its inception, it has seen numerous updates and iterations, including the robust OLED model that boasts enhanced visuals and audio quality, making gaming more immersive than ever.

Comparison: Nintendo Switch vs. Other Consoles

When benchmarked against other gaming consoles like the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X, the Nintendo Switch offers a unique proposition. While competitors focus on raw power and graphics, the Switch emphasizes versatility and accessibility. It’s the only major console that allows players to transition between handheld and traditional formats without compromising game quality. Furthermore, its game library prominently features family-friendly titles, party games, and innovative experiences that are perfect for casual players.

For competitive gamers, both the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X provide higher-performance hardware that excels in 4K gaming and frame rates. However, the Switch’s exclusive games and playful aesthetic appeal to a different demographic, often targeting younger audiences and those seeking innovative gameplay.

Setting Up Your Nintendo Switch in Different Modes

One of the appealing features of the Nintendo Switch is its ability to function in multiple modes: TV mode, tabletop mode, and handheld mode. Here’s how to set it up for each:

TV Mode: Dock the Switch into the docking station, connect it to your TV with an HDMI cable, and switch on your console. This mode is perfect for home gaming sessions with friends.

Tabletop Mode: Flip out the kickstand on the back of the device. This mode enables you to share the screen with friends and play multiplayer games comfortably without the need for a television.

Handheld Mode: Simply detach the console from the dock, grab your Joy-Con controllers, and play anywhere! The touch screen adds a personal touch to gaming on the go.

Improving Performance and Battery Life

To ensure your Nintendo Switch runs efficiently, consider these tips to boost both performance and battery life:

  • Update Your Console: Regularly check for system updates to optimize performance and gameplay features.
  • Lower Brightness Settings: Dimming the screen brightness can significantly extend battery life during portable play.
  • Manage Sleep Mode: Make certain the console goes into sleep mode when not in use to conserve energy.
  • Close Background Applications: Ensure you exit games and applications when they’re not in use to improve performance.

Participating in Nintendo Switch Online Services

By subscribing to Nintendo Switch Online, players gain access to online multiplayer functionality, cloud saves, and a library of classic NES and SNES games. Joining this service can dramatically enrich your gaming experience.
